TravellingBritNY Posted February 8, 2019 #2 Share Posted February 8, 2019 Spotts Beach all the way! It's not a 100% thing - I have been there and not seen one, but it's your best chance if you want to see then in the wild. No idea of cab costs - I have a rental car when I an on island. Gatorzzzz Posted February 16, 2019 #4 Share Posted February 16, 2019 (edited) I went to Spotts Beach last month. It was fantastic. Make sure to take a snorkeling vest, the current can be strong.
